Consolo, Aquino of Pru. Douglas Elliman bring Variazioni to Mulberry St.

The leasing team of Faith Hope Consolo, chairman, and Joseph Aquino, executive vice president, of Prudential Douglas Elliman's Retail Leasing and Sales Division, exclusively represented the tenant in bringing Variazioni to retail space at 214 Mulberry St., between Spring and Prince Sts. Consolo and Aquino will continue to represent the label throughout its planned national expansion, including up to 12 additional stores.
Variazioni's newest store will open in 1,000 s/f on two levels.
Arthur Maglio joined Consolo and Aquino in The Agency assignment. Joshua Halegua represented the landlord, Jonis Realty Management, in-house.
Consolo and Aquino have also been named exclusive agent for retail space at 675 Sixth Ave., which takes up the entire block from 21st to 22nd Sts. and is currently occupied by a national bookstore.
The 41,700 s/f space is comprised of a 35,000 s/f ground floor selling level, a 4,000 s/f mezzanine and 2,700 s/f of basement support space. The building also boasts 200 ft. of frontage along Sixth Ave.
